Tottenham Hotspur have completely changed their initial plan on the type of sporting director they want to appoint, and one senior Spurs man could be on his way out.Several sporting directors have been linked with Spurs over the last few months, and it appeared as if Sebastian Kehl had become the leading contender to join Tottenham.However, there has been no concrete movement over the last few days, and it appears that the Lilywhites may have changed their plans as they look for the right man for the role.Over the past few days, a number of outlets have claimed that Spurs are weighing up Johan Lange’s future at the club, and a new update has shed light on how the club’s stance has changed.Credit: Tottenham Hotspur / YouTubeTottenham want to appoint a world-class sporting directorThe Athletic’s Jack Pitt-Brooke has revealed that Tottenham’s search for a new sporting director began months ago, with the club on the lookout for a new man ever since Fabio Paratici left the club.Interestingly, it is revealed that Spurs’ initial brief was to find someone who could work alongside Lange at Hotspur Way.The club wanted someone with experience working in a structure and a director who is used to being a number two rather than the sole decision-maker.However, the Tottenham hierarchy have now done a U-turn and are looking for someone completely different. The Lilywhites have now decided to appoint a world-class operator as their next sporting director, with Lange’s future at the club now unclear.Lewis family expected to make money available for Spurs this summerPitt-Brooke also reveals that more money will be made available by the Lewis family, who are expected to fund another cash injection into the club, similar to the one they did in October of last year.While not all of that cash will be invested on new players, it is expected to help the club’s leadership in rebuilding the squad ahead of next season.The Athletic journalist concludes his article by asserting that no matter who Tottenham appoint as the sporting director, De Zerbi will have to be given the final say on the rebuild, given the huge political capital he has accumulated by keeping the club in the Premier League.READ MORE: Roberto De Zerbi receives disappointing news regarding £86m Tottenham targetThe post Tottenham make U-turn on new sporting director plans, Johan Lange could be the big loser appeared first on Spurs Web.
